DISABLED AMERICAN VETERANS SAN PEDRO VALLEY CHAPTER 26, founded in 2005, is a small nonprofit that reported $150K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ue decreased 14% compared to the prior year. The organization ran a surplus of $44K, a strong 30% operating margin.

Mission

ASSIST VETERANS WIDOWS AND THEIR FAMILIES
